The Foundation of Proper Sample Storage: Understanding the Enemies
Before we dive into the “how,” let’s understand the “why.” The primary goal of storing EDP samples is to protect them from three main enemies: light, heat, and oxygen.
- Light: Both natural sunlight and artificial light, especially UV rays, can break down the molecular structure of fragrance oils. This process, known as photodegradation, can alter the scent, often causing top notes to fade and the overall fragrance to smell “off” or “stale.”
-
Heat: High temperatures accelerate chemical reactions, including those that cause fragrance degradation. Heat can cause ingredients to evaporate faster and can even lead to the breakdown of some molecules, changing the scent entirely. Think of a hot car in summer; the contents of a perfume bottle stored there are a prime example of heat damage.
-
Oxygen: Over time, exposure to air can cause oxidation, a process where oxygen reacts with fragrance molecules. This can lead to the formation of new compounds, which can smell unpleasant, often described as “sour” or “plastic-like.” While a small amount of air is introduced each time a sample is opened, our goal is to minimize this exposure over the long term.
The First Step: Immediate Action After Unboxing
The moment a new EDP sample arrives, a series of actions should be taken to set the stage for its long-term preservation.
- Check the Seal: Visually inspect the sample vial. Is the cap on tightly? If it’s a spray atomizer, is the nozzle secure? Even a tiny leak can lead to significant evaporation over time. If the cap feels loose, gently press it down and twist until it feels snug. For vials with a dauber, ensure the stopper is fully inserted.
-
Wipe Down the Exterior: Sometimes, a small amount of fragrance residue from the filling process can be on the outside of the vial. Use a clean, lint-free cloth to gently wipe the exterior. This prevents the residue from attracting dust or becoming sticky over time, which can make a container difficult to open later.
-
Label and Date: This is a non-negotiable step for any serious fragrance enthusiast. Use a fine-tipped, permanent marker or a small label to mark the vial with the fragrance name and the date you received it. This helps you track the sample’s age and allows you to prioritize using older samples first. A simple system, like
Frédéric Malle - Portrait of a Lady (08/25)
, provides all the necessary information at a glance.
The Core of Storage: The ‘Cool, Dark, and Airtight’ Principle
This is the golden rule of fragrance storage, applicable to both full bottles and samples. But for samples, the implementation is more specific and often more critical due to their smaller size and greater vulnerability.
The ‘Dark’ Component: Shielding from Light
- Avoid Transparent Containers: Do not store samples in clear plastic containers or on open shelves where they are exposed to light. A clear container is an aesthetic trap; it allows you to see your collection, but it also allows light to pass through, causing damage.
-
Choose Opaque Storage: The best storage containers are opaque.
- Small, dedicated boxes: Think of jewelry boxes, cigar boxes, or even dedicated fragrance sample boxes sold by some companies. The key here is a solid, non-transparent material like wood, metal, or thick cardboard.
-
Drawers and Cabinets: A dresser drawer or a cabinet that is not frequently opened is an excellent, readily available option. Ensure the samples are not at the top of the drawer, where they might be exposed to light every time the drawer is opened slightly.
-
Velvet or satin pouches: For a smaller collection, individual pouches for each sample can work wonders. The opaque fabric blocks light, and the soft material provides a layer of physical protection against knocks and bumps.
Concrete Example: Instead of leaving a dozen samples in a clear plastic container on your vanity, place them in a small, wooden trinket box with a hinged lid. Store this box in your dresser drawer, out of direct sunlight and artificial light.
The ‘Cool’ Component: Maintaining a Stable Temperature
- Avoid Bathrooms: Bathrooms are the absolute worst place to store any fragrance. The constant fluctuations in temperature and humidity from showers and baths create a hostile environment that rapidly degrades scents.
-
Steer Clear of Windowsills and Vents: This seems obvious, but it’s a common mistake. A windowsill exposes samples to direct sunlight and heat. Similarly, storing them near a heating vent or air conditioner vent can subject them to rapid temperature changes and drafts, which are also detrimental.
-
Identify a Stable Location: A bedroom dresser, a closet shelf, or a dedicated, cool storage room are ideal. The key is a location with a consistent, moderate temperature. A good rule of thumb is to store them in a place where you would be comfortable, but not a place where you’d need a fan or heater running constantly.
Concrete Example: Rather than keeping your samples on a bathroom shelf for easy access, designate a specific drawer in your bedroom nightstand. The nightstand is away from windows and vents, and the drawer provides a consistent, cool, and dark environment.
The ‘Airtight’ Component: Minimizing Oxygen Exposure
- The Vial Itself: The design of the sample vial plays a role. Spray atomizers, when properly sealed, offer the best protection against air exposure. Dauber vials are more prone to letting in air and evaporation.
-
The Container: While the vial itself is the primary barrier, the larger storage container can provide a secondary layer of protection.
- Airtight containers: For a dedicated and long-term storage solution, consider using a small, airtight plastic container with a secure lid, like those used for food storage. Place the samples inside, and the container will act as a buffer against humidity and air fluctuations.
-
Ziplock Bags: As a simple, affordable, and effective solution, placing a few samples in a small, dedicated Ziplock bag can help. It’s not a truly airtight solution, but it significantly reduces the amount of air exposure and helps to contain any small leaks.
Concrete Example: Place your dozen labeled samples into a small, airtight food storage container (the kind with a secure clip-on lid). This container then goes into the cool, dark drawer in your nightstand. This provides multiple layers of protection: a dark drawer, an opaque container, and a secure lid.
Organizing Your Collection: The Key to Long-Term Management
Proper storage is not just about protection; it’s also about accessibility and organization. A well-organized collection is easier to maintain and use, which in turn encourages better storage habits.
Categorization Systems:
- By Fragrance Family: This is a popular method for enthusiasts. Group samples by family: Florals, Orientals, Woody, Fresh, etc. This makes it easy to grab a scent that matches your mood or the season.
-
By House/Brand: If you are exploring the catalog of a specific perfumer or house, this is a logical system. Grouping all your samples from Chanel, Diptyque, or Tom Ford together allows you to track your preferences and compare scents within a single brand.
-
By ‘To-Try’ and ‘Keep’ Status: This is a practical, ongoing system. When you receive a sample, it goes into a “To-Try” container. Once you’ve worn it and decided you either love it or don’t, it moves to either a “Keep” or a “Discard” container. This helps you track your progress and avoid accumulating samples you have no interest in.
-
Alphabetical Order: Simple, clean, and effective for larger collections where you know exactly what you’re looking for.
Concrete Example: Let’s say you have a collection of 50 samples. Instead of one large box, use a multi-compartment organizer. Label the compartments: “Citrus & Fresh,” “Floral,” “Woody & Amber,” and “Gourmand.” This allows you to quickly locate a specific scent type without rummaging through the entire collection, minimizing the time the samples are exposed to air and light.
The Role of Physical Protection
Beyond the chemical and environmental threats, physical damage is a real risk. A dropped vial can shatter, and a loose cap can lead to spillage and evaporation.
- Padded or Divided Containers: Look for storage solutions that offer some form of padding or individual dividers. Velvet-lined boxes or containers with foam inserts are excellent for this. The padding prevents the delicate glass vials from knocking against each other and potentially cracking.
-
Secure Lids: A simple box is not enough if the lid doesn’t stay closed. Ensure your storage container has a secure closure, whether it’s a clasp, a tight-fitting lid, or even a drawer that is difficult to open accidentally.
-
Avoid Overpacking: Do not cram too many samples into a single container. This increases the risk of them bumping into each other and makes it difficult to retrieve a single vial without disturbing the others.
Concrete Example: Purchase a small, velvet-lined jewelry box with dedicated slots for rings and earrings. These slots are often the perfect size to hold individual sample vials securely, preventing them from rolling around and clinking together. The soft lining also acts as a cushion against minor shocks.
The Long-Term Preservation and Management Routine
Effective storage isn’t a one-time task; it’s a routine. A few simple habits will ensure your samples remain in peak condition for as long as possible.
- Routine Checks: Every few months, open your storage container and quickly inspect your samples. Check for any signs of evaporation or discoloration. A dark or cloudy appearance in a liquid that was once clear could be a sign of degradation. A quick check of the cap is also a good idea.
-
Minimize ‘Rummaging’: When you need to retrieve a sample, do it efficiently. Know what you’re looking for and grab it quickly. Avoid the temptation to spend a long time looking at and handling every sample. The less they are exposed to the outside world, the better.
-
Use Oldest Samples First: Remember that labeling system? Use it. When you’re choosing a scent for the day, consciously try to use a sample that you’ve had for a longer period. This “first in, first out” principle ensures you get to experience the fragrance in its intended form before it has a chance to degrade.
Concrete Example: Create a monthly reminder on your phone to “Check Fragrance Samples.” When the reminder pops up, open your storage box, quickly scan for any visible issues, and make a mental note of which samples you’ve had the longest. The next time you’re choosing a scent, you’ll be primed to pick one from that “oldest” group.
